About (2R,3R,4R,5S,6R)-6-[2-[2-(2-chloro-6-fluoroanilino)-5-methylphenyl]acetyl]oxy-3,4,5-trihydroxyoxane-2-carboxylic acid

(2R,3R,4R,5S,6R)-6-[2-[2-(2-chloro-6-fluoroanilino)-5-methylphenyl]acetyl]oxy-3,4,5-trihydroxyoxane-2-carboxylic acid (PubChem CID 71749854) has the molecular formula C21H21ClFNO8 and a molecular weight of 469.85 g/mol. Its IUPAC name is (2R,3R,4R,5S,6R)-6-[2-[2-(2-chloro-6-fluoroanilino)-5-methylphenyl]acetyl]oxy-3,4,5-trihydroxyoxane-2-carboxylic acid.
